What Features Should You Look for in the Best Camera for Night Photography?

When searching for the best camera to shoot at night, consider the following key features:

  • Low-Light Performance: A camera’s ability to perform in low-light conditions is crucial for night photography. Look for cameras with larger sensors, such as full-frame or APS-C, as they can capture more light, resulting in clearer and more detailed images.
  • High ISO Range: A high ISO capability allows for better performance in dim lighting without producing excessive noise. Cameras that can handle ISO settings up to 6400 or higher are ideal, as they enable you to shoot in darker environments while maintaining image quality.
  • Image Stabilization: This feature helps to reduce the effects of camera shake, which is particularly important in low-light situations where longer exposure times are often required. Optical or in-body image stabilization can lead to sharper images and allow you to shoot at slower shutter speeds.
  • Fast Lenses: Lenses with wide apertures (e.g., f/1.4 or f/2.8) allow more light to enter the camera, making them ideal for night photography. A fast lens can help you achieve better focus and exposure in low-light conditions, resulting in more vibrant and detailed photographs.
  • Manual Controls: The ability to manually adjust settings such as aperture, shutter speed, and ISO is essential for night photography. Cameras that offer full manual control allow you to fine-tune your exposure settings to capture the best possible images in challenging lighting conditions.
  • Good Autofocus System: A reliable autofocus system is vital for capturing sharp images at night. Look for cameras with advanced autofocus technologies, such as phase detection or contrast detection, which can help achieve focus even in low-light situations.
  • Dynamic Range: A camera with a wide dynamic range can capture more detail in both the shadows and highlights of a scene. This feature is especially beneficial for night photography, where you may encounter bright lights and dark areas in the same image.
  • Built-in Wi-Fi or Bluetooth: Having connectivity features like Wi-Fi or Bluetooth allows for easier sharing and transferring of images from your camera to your smartphone or computer. This is particularly useful for night photographers who want to quickly share their work on social media or back up their files.

Why is a Full-Frame Sensor Beneficial for Low-Light Conditions?

A full-frame sensor is beneficial for low-light conditions primarily because it has a larger surface area compared to crop sensors, allowing it to capture more light and produce higher-quality images in dark environments.

According to a study published in the Journal of Optical Society of America, larger sensors can collect more photons, which directly translates into better signal-to-noise ratios in low-light scenarios (Smith et al., 2020). This means that full-frame sensors can maintain image clarity and detail even when the light is scarce, making them ideal for night photography.

The underlying mechanism for this advantage lies in the physical properties of the sensor. A full-frame sensor, measuring approximately 36mm x 24mm, can house larger individual pixels, which are capable of capturing more light. This reduces the noise that typically manifests in images taken at high ISO settings, which is common in low-light photography. As the sensor size increases, the depth of field also becomes shallower, allowing for more artistic effects while maintaining sharp focus on the subject.

Furthermore, full-frame sensors often have more advanced technologies, such as superior dynamic range and enhanced ISO performance. This results in images that retain better detail in both shadows and highlights. A study by the International Society for Photogrammetry and Remote Sensing highlighted that full-frame cameras outperform their smaller counterparts in low-light environments, delivering images with finer detail and less grain (Jones, 2021). This capability makes full-frame sensors the preferred choice for photographers seeking the best camera to shoot at night.

Why is a Tripod Essential for Night Photography?

A tripod is essential for night photography primarily due to its ability to stabilize the camera during long exposure shots. Here’s why using a tripod can significantly enhance your night photography:

  • Minimized Camera Shake: At night, the available light is significantly reduced, necessitating longer shutter speeds. Even the slightest movement can result in blurred images. A sturdy tripod eliminates this risk, ensuring sharp, clear photos.

  • Greater Creative Control: Tripods allow photographers to experiment with various exposure settings. You can take longer shots to capture motion blur or use techniques like light painting without worrying about holding the camera steadily.

  • Improved Composition: With a tripod, photographers can take their time to compose each shot carefully. It’s easier to frame a scene precisely when the camera is securely mounted, leading to better results.

  • Flexibility in Angles: Many tripods come with adjustable legs and heads that allow for shooting at various angles and heights. This versatility is particularly useful for night landscapes and urban scenes.

  • Less Fatigue: Holding a camera for extended periods, especially in low-light conditions, can be tiring. A tripod supports the camera, allowing you to focus more on composition and settings without physical strain.

Investing in a quality tripod can greatly enhance the quality of night photography, making it an indispensable tool for photographers aiming to capture stunning images in low-light conditions.

What Techniques Can Help You Master Night Photography?

Several techniques can enhance your night photography skills and improve your results significantly.

  • Use a Tripod: A sturdy tripod is essential for night photography as it stabilizes your camera during long exposure shots. This prevents camera shake and helps capture sharp images in low light conditions.
  • Utilize a Fast Lens: A lens with a wide aperture (like f/1.8 or f/2.8) allows more light to enter the camera, making it easier to shoot in darker environments. Fast lenses are particularly effective for capturing details and achieving a shallow depth of field.
  • Adjust ISO Settings: Increasing the ISO sensitivity of your camera can help you capture images in lower light without using a flash. However, be cautious as higher ISO settings can introduce noise, which may degrade image quality.
  • Experiment with Long Exposures: Long exposure techniques, where the shutter remains open for several seconds or minutes, can create stunning effects, such as light trails from cars or star movements. This technique requires a tripod and careful exposure settings to avoid overexposure.
  • Use Manual Focus: Autofocus systems may struggle in low light, so switching to manual focus ensures you can precisely focus on your subject. This is particularly useful for subjects at a distance or when shooting in very dim conditions.
  • Incorporate Light Sources: Using additional light sources, such as flashlights or LED panels, can illuminate your subject and add creative effects. This technique can help define details in shadowy environments and create interesting compositions.
  • Take Advantage of the Right Time: The “blue hour,” which occurs just after sunset or before sunrise, provides a beautiful natural light that can enhance night photography. Shooting during this time can yield stunning colors and contrast in your images.
  • Post-Processing Techniques: After capturing your images, using software like Adobe Lightroom or Photoshop can help enhance colors, reduce noise, and sharpen details. Post-processing is vital for achieving the best results, especially in low-light photos where adjustments may significantly improve clarity.

How Can Long Exposures Improve Your Night Photography Results?

Long exposures can significantly enhance night photography by allowing more light to reach the camera sensor, resulting in brighter and more detailed images.

  • Increased Light Capture: Long exposures enable the camera to gather more light over an extended period, which is crucial in low-light conditions like nighttime. This allows for the capture of details that would otherwise be lost in a standard exposure.
  • Creative Effects: By using long exposures, photographers can create stunning visual effects, such as light trails from moving vehicles or the smooth, ethereal look of water in motion. These creative opportunities can transform a simple scene into a captivating image.
  • Improved Image Quality: Longer exposures can reduce noise that often plagues night photography, especially at high ISO settings. By allowing the camera to gather light slowly, the images can have a cleaner, more polished appearance, enhancing overall quality.
  • Star Trails and Night Sky Photography: For astrophotography, long exposures are essential to capture the movement of stars across the sky, creating beautiful star trails. This technique allows photographers to depict the celestial sphere in a way that reveals its dynamic nature.
  • Use of Tripods: Long exposures necessitate stable equipment, making tripods essential for night photography. A steady tripod allows for longer shutter speeds without introducing motion blur, ensuring sharp and clear images.
